@@ -218,6 +218,22 @@
if (info != null && info.getLinkSpeed() != -1) {
addRow(group, R.string.wifi_speed, info.getLinkSpeed() + WifiInfo.LINK_SPEED_UNITS);
}
+ if (info != null && info.getFrequency() != -1) {
+ // Since the frequency is defined on MHz, we need to simplify it
+ // to just 2.4GHz (regardless of the locale) or 5GHz.
+ int frequency = info.getFrequency();
+ String band = null;
+ if (frequency >= 2400 && frequency < 2500) {
+ band = "2.4GHz";
+ } else if (frequency >= 5000 && frequency < 6000) {
+ band = "5GHz";
+ } else {
+ Log.e(TAG, "Unexpected frequency " + frequency);
+ }
+ if (band != null) {
+ addRow(group, R.string.wifi_frequency, band);
+ }
+ }
